Metro Atlanta residents who live in Fulton, Cobb, DeKalb or Gwinnett counties can drop off their absentee ballots over the weekend and on Monday, Nov. 4, the day before Election Day, at their local election offices.
The last day of early in-person voting is Friday, Nov. 1, but residents in these counties can continue dropping off their absentee ballots at these times and locations before Election Day. On Election Day, offices will be open from 7 a.m. to 7 p.m. for hand returning absentee ballots.
Clayton County will not have locations open this weekend for hand-returning absentee ballots, but Clayton residents can return their absentee ballots by hand on Monday, Nov. 4, from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m. and on Election Day on Tuesday, Nov. 5, from 7 a.m. to 7 p.m. at the Jonesboro Historical Courthouse, South Clayton Recreation Center and Carl Rhodenizer Recreation Center.
